Analysis

The most recent figure for harmonised index of consumer prices (hicp) - ecoicop ver.2 - first in Iceland is 107.6 Index, 2025=100, measured in 2026. That is the highest value across all 12 years on record.

That represents a change of up 6.7% on the previous year and up 42.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, harmonised index of consumer prices (hicp) - ecoicop ver.2 - first in Iceland peaked at 107.6 Index, 2025=100 in 2026 and was at its lowest, 74.67 Index, 2025=100, in 2017.

That places Iceland 6th out of 49 countries with data for 2026,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 12 years of available data.

Harmonised index of consumer prices (HICP) - ECOICOP ver.2 - first in Iceland, year by year

Annual values for Harmonised index of consumer prices (HICP) - ECOICOP ver.2 - first released data in Iceland, 2015 to 2026.
Year Index, 2025=100 Change
2015 75.53 Index, 2025=100
2016 75.44 Index, 2025=100 -0.1%
2017 74.67 Index, 2025=100 -1.0%
2018 76.14 Index, 2025=100 +2.0%
2019 76.84 Index, 2025=100 +0.9%
2020 78.64 Index, 2025=100 +2.3%
2021 81.67 Index, 2025=100 +3.9%
2022 87.57 Index, 2025=100 +7.2%
2023 93.61 Index, 2025=100 +6.9%
2024 96.95 Index, 2025=100 +3.6%
2025 100.86 Index, 2025=100 +4.0%
2026 107.6 Index, 2025=100 +6.7%
